HIV Prevention and Care Engagement in Nepal
HIV Prevention and Care Engagement in Nepal

NCT07528573

CompletedNA

Sponsor: Public Health Foundation Enterprises, Inc.

Conditions: HIV

Interventions: Sweekar intervention

Countries: Nepal

This intervention focuses on increasing HIV testing, HIV medication adherence and reducing intersectional stigma. Our Sweekar intervention will implement 5 months of group-based activities to address the social stigma and HIV prevention and care needs.

Eligibility overview

Sex: FEMALE

Age: 18 Years to

Healthy volunteers: Yes

Study type: INTERVENTIONAL

Eligibility criteria
Inclusion Criteria:

1. aged 18 years old or older
2. identify as transgender, hijra, Meti, third gender or anything other than a gender typically associated with a male assigned sex at birth
3. live in the Terai highway district Madesh Province
4. Maithili- or Nepali-speaking
5. Willing to be part of the study for 6 months
6. Willing to travel, if needed, to participate in group sessions

For those who test HIV negative:

1. Willing to self-test
2. Have or willing to have a mobile phone
3. Not HIV tested within the last 3 months

For those who test HIV positive:

(a) screen positive for HIV treatment non-adherence by self-report

Exclusion Criteria:

1. Cannot or will not consent to the research,
2. Female sex assigned at birth,
3. Self-identify as a man
4. Do not speak Maithli or Nepali
5. Age under 18 -
